spring.iml是什么
-
spring.iml是Spring框架项目中的一个配置文件,它使用XML格式定义了Spring项目的相关配置信息。在使用Spring框架开发项目时,开发者可以使用spring.iml文件来配置项目的各种参数和组件。该文件位于项目的根目录下的.idea文件夹中。
spring.iml文件主要用于指定项目的依赖关系和构建配置。它包含了项目的模块信息、编译选项、依赖库等等。通过该文件,我们可以配置项目的类路径、输出目录、源码文件(包括源码、测试代码等)的目录结构等。
在spring.iml文件中,可以添加和删除项目的依赖项,包括外部库、JAR包和其他项目模块。通过配置这些依赖项,我们可以实现项目的模块化开发和依赖管理,并且能够通过简单的配置来引入需要的功能和功能模块。
除了依赖管理外,spring.iml文件还可以配置项目的构建选项,例如指定项目的编译版本、Java版本、输出目录等。通过这些配置,我们可以定制项目的构建过程,以满足我们的需求。
总之,spring.iml是Spring框架项目的配置文件,用于管理项目的依赖关系和构建配置。通过合理配置该文件,我们可以更好地管理和开发Spring框架项目。
1年前 -
spring.iml是一个IntelliJ IDEA项目的配置文件,主要用于记录项目的依赖关系和配置。下面是关于spring.iml的一些重要信息:
-
文件作用:spring.iml文件是IntelliJ IDEA项目的模块配置文件。它存储了项目的配置信息,包括模块的依赖关系、资源文件的路径、源码文件的路径等。
-
依赖关系:在spring.iml文件中,可以配置项目所需要的依赖库,包括jar包或者其他模块的依赖。通过添加依赖,可以使项目能够访问和使用相应的库。
-
资源文件配置:在spring.iml文件中,可以配置项目中使用的资源文件的路径。例如,可以指定项目中的配置文件、静态资源文件、模板文件等的位置。
-
源码文件配置:除了资源文件之外,spring.iml文件还可以配置项目中各个模块的源码文件的路径。这样可以方便开发人员在IDE中查看和管理项目的源代码。
-
共享配置:spring.iml文件可以被团队协作时共享。在项目中使用版本控制工具(例如Git),将项目的配置文件一同提交到版本库中,使团队成员可以共享相同的项目设置。
总之,spring.iml是IntelliJ IDEA项目的重要配置文件,用于记录项目依赖关系、资源文件的路径和源码文件的路径等信息,方便项目的开发和协作。
1年前 -
-
spring.iml是IntelliJ IDEA工程文件中用来存储有关Spring框架的相关配置信息的文件。在使用IntelliJ IDEA进行Spring项目开发时,每个项目都会自动生成一个名为spring.iml的文件,它记录了项目的所有依赖、模块、构建配置等信息。
spring.iml文件是基于XML格式的配置文件,它包含了项目的各种配置元素,例如模块的依赖关系、编译配置、输出路径、源码路径等。下面将介绍spring.iml文件中的一些主要配置元素以及它们的含义和用法。
-
模块依赖关系配置:spring.iml文件中使用<orderEntry>元素来配置模块之间的依赖关系。通过指定<orderEntry>元素的type、module-name等属性,可以定义模块之间的编译顺序和依赖关系。
-
编译配置:spring.iml文件中使用<compiler>元素来配置项目的编译选项。可以设置<compiler>元素的属性,如source-version、target-version、annotation-processing等,来定义编译的相关设置。
-
输出路径配置:spring.iml文件中使用<output>元素来配置项目的输出路径。可以通过设置<output>元素的url属性,来指定编译后的.class文件的输出路径。
-
源码路径配置:spring.iml文件中使用<sourceFolder>元素来配置项目的源码路径。通过设置<sourceFolder>元素的url属性,可以指定项目的源码文件的路径。
-
外部库依赖配置:spring.iml文件中使用<library>元素来配置项目的外部库依赖。可以通过设置<library>元素的name、type等属性,来指定所依赖的外部库的名称和类型。
-
模块类型配置:spring.iml文件中使用<facet>元素来配置项目所使用的模块类型。通过设置<facet>元素的type属性,可以指定项目的模块类型,如Spring、Java、Web等。
总之,spring.iml文件是IntelliJ IDEA用来存储Spring项目配置信息的文件,其中包含了项目的依赖关系、编译配置、输出路径、源码路径、外部库依赖等相关信息。通过对spring.iml文件的配置,可以方便地管理和维护Spring项目的开发环境。
1年前 -